Elephant Shell is Tokyo Police Club's 2008 debut album, and it carries the pressure of a band whose short early releases had already made them feel overdiscussed before a first LP existed. Instead of inflating themselves, they made a record that stays clipped, anxious and quick on its feet. Centennial, In A Cave, Graves, Juno, Tessellate and Your English Is Good all move with the band's signature economy: guitar lines that jab rather than sprawl, bass that keeps the songs elastic, keyboards used as sparks, and Dave Monks' voice pushing images through a tight melodic filter. At under half an hour, the album understands that Tokyo Police Club's strength is compression. It is not a grand debut in the old rock sense; it is a precise one, built from miniature charges of melody, literate restlessness and the particular blog-era excitement of a young band refusing to slow down.

It matters because Elephant Shell turned Tokyo Police Club's early promise into a full-length identity without padding the formula. The album helped define the band's place in late-2000s indie rock: fast, clever, melodic and compact enough to feel instantly replayable.

For collectors, Elephant Shell is the first Tokyo Police Club album and the bridge from the A Lesson In Crime EP into the main discography. It is the record to own for Tessellate, In A Cave, Juno and the band's original burst of compressed guitar-pop energy.

Compressed indie rock with angular guitar, quick rhythms, bright keyboard accents, bookish lyrics, nervous vocals, melodic bass movement and songs that favor impact over length.
